bnx2i Driver Messages
The bnx2i driver messages include the following.
BNX2I Driver Sign-on
QLogic BCM57xx and BCM57xxx iSCSI Driver bnx2i v2.1.1D (May 12,
2015)
Network Port to iSCSI Transport Name Binding
bnx2i: netif=eth2, iscsi=bcm570x-050000
bnx2i: netif=eth1, iscsi=bcm570x-030c00
Driver Completes Handshake with iSCSI Offload-enabled C-NIC Device
bnx2i [05:00.00]: ISCSI_INIT passed
Driver Detects iSCSI Offload Is Not Enabled on the C-NIC Device
bnx2i: iSCSI not supported, dev=eth3
bnx2i: bnx2i: LOM is not enabled to offload iSCSI connections,
dev=eth0
bnx2i: dev eth0 does not support iSCSI
NOTE
This message is displayed only when the user attempts to make an iSCSI
connection.
